對于很多初學(xué)者來說,使用云服務(wù)器上的應(yīng)用程序時,其中一個潛在的問題是如何使這些應(yīng)用程序具備外網(wǎng)訪問能力。本文將詳細討論如何使用云服務(wù)器來實現(xiàn)外網(wǎng)訪問功能。
第一步:選擇云服務(wù)器
首先需要選擇一家云服務(wù)提供商并購買一臺云服務(wù)器。在選擇云服務(wù)提供商時要考慮以下幾點:
1. 云服務(wù)提供商的信譽度。
2. 云服務(wù)器的性能以及與其他云服務(wù)器的定價比較。
3. 云服務(wù)提供商的數(shù)據(jù)安全和可靠性。
當(dāng)然,還有很多其他的因素需要考慮,但這些是最重要的因素。
第二步:選擇操作系統(tǒng)和應(yīng)用程序
選擇云服務(wù)器后,需要選擇一個操作系統(tǒng)來安裝在云服務(wù)器上。根據(jù)不同的操作系統(tǒng),需要使用不同的指令和工具來設(shè)置和配置外網(wǎng)訪問功能。在選擇操作系統(tǒng)時,請務(wù)必考慮您的應(yīng)用程序的兼容性,并選擇與您的應(yīng)用程序兼容的操作系統(tǒng)。
操作系統(tǒng)選擇好后,需要安裝一些必要的應(yīng)用程序。這些應(yīng)用程序包括 web 服務(wù)器和防火墻等,以便使您的應(yīng)用程序可以順利地運行和保護您的云服務(wù)器。
第三步:配置云服務(wù)器
一旦選擇好操作系統(tǒng)和必要的應(yīng)用程序后,就需要開始配置您的云服務(wù)器。配置包含以下幾個步驟:
1. 打開防火墻端口。
外網(wǎng)訪問需要開放相應(yīng)的端口,如果您使用 linux 操作系統(tǒng),可以使用以下命令來打開端口:
sudo iptables -i input -p tcp –dport 80 -j accept
2. 更新系統(tǒng)軟件包。
為保持?jǐn)?shù)據(jù)的安全性,在配置外網(wǎng)訪問功能前,應(yīng)先更新您的操作系統(tǒng)及其他應(yīng)用程序的軟件包,以確保系統(tǒng)中的漏洞被及時修補。
3. 配置負載均衡器。
如果您的應(yīng)用程序需要處理大量的外部請求,那么您可能需要將請求分配到多個云服務(wù)器上。使用一個負載均衡器可以幫助您實現(xiàn)這個目標(biāo)。
配置負載均衡器需要先選擇一種負載均衡器模式,然后設(shè)置負載均衡器規(guī)則。例如,使用 haproxy 負載均衡器,您可以設(shè)置以下規(guī)則:
frontend web
bind *:80
default_backend webservers
backend webservers
balance roundrobin
server web1 192.168.0.1:80 check
server web2 192.168.0.2:80 check
第四步:將應(yīng)用程序發(fā)布到云服務(wù)器上
一旦完成配置,就可以將您的應(yīng)用程序發(fā)布到云服務(wù)器上了。完成發(fā)布后,您可以通過云服務(wù)器的公網(wǎng) ip 地址進行訪問。
如果您的應(yīng)用程序需要使用域名來訪問,那么您需要將域名映射到云服務(wù)器的公網(wǎng) ip 地址。這可以在您的域名注冊商處設(shè)置。
總結(jié)
以上就是使用云服務(wù)器實現(xiàn)外網(wǎng)訪問功能的完整過程。需要注意的是,在配置外網(wǎng)訪問功能時需要確保數(shù)據(jù)的安全性。此外,對于初學(xué)者來說,配置過程可能會有些困難,但隨著經(jīng)驗的積累,這將變得越來越簡單。希望本文能讓您更好地了解如何在云服務(wù)器上實現(xiàn)外網(wǎng)訪問功能。
以上就是小編關(guān)于“怎么用云服務(wù)器上外網(wǎng)訪問”的分享和介紹